#1 of 30 Things To Do in Las Vegas Fountains of Bellagio Las Vegas NV ~0.01 miles from Las Vegas city center Hotels Close to Fountains of Bellagio The Fountains of Bellagio is a vast, choreographed water feature with performances set to light and music. (See musical fountain.) The performances take place in front of the Bellagio hotel and are visible from numerous vantage points on the Strip, both from the street and neighboring structures. The show takes place every 30 minutes in the afternoons and early evenings, and every 15 minutes from 8 p.m. to midnight. Before a water show starts, the nozzles break the water surface. Shows may be cancelled without warning because of wind, although shows usually run with less power in face of wind; a single show may be skipped to avoid interference with a planned event. Attraction type: Aquarium, Zoo, Wildlife park, Landmark/point of interest, OtherActivities: Group Tours/Walking Tour, Viewing Wildlife, Swimming With Dolphinshttp://www.miragehabitat.com/mgiannantonio@mirage.comAddress: 3400 Las Vegas Boulevard South In the Mirage Hotel Las Vegas, NV 89109Tel: 702 791 7188Fax: 702 792 7684 | #10 of 30 Things To Do in Las Vegas Guggenheim Hermitage Museum Las Vegas NV ~0.65 miles from Las Vegas city center Hotels Close to Guggenheim Hermitage Museum The Guggenheim Hermitage Museum was a museum in The Venetian, one of the world's largest hotels in Paradise, Nevada, located on the Strip in Las Vegas, USA. It was designed by Rem Koolhaas, opened October 7, 2001, and added three more collections and exhibits subsequent to its opening. It was the result of a collaboration agreement between the State Hermitage Museum in St Petersburg, Russia, and the Solomon R. Guggenheim Foundation.The museum finished its seven-year tenure at The Venetian on May 11, 2008. It is now permanently closed. A new Guggenheim Hermitage Museum is to be built in Vilnius, Lituania. This branch is in the heart of Las Vegas. | #12 of 30 Things To Do in Las Vegas Grand Canal Shoppes Las Vegas NV ~0.65 miles from Las Vegas city center Hotels Close to Grand Canal Shoppes The Grand Canal Shoppes is an 500,000 sq ft (46,000 m2) upscale shopping mall adjacent to The Venetian Hotel & Casino and The Palazzo on the Las Vegas Strip in Paradise, Nevada.The mall was opened along with the Venetian in 1999. The mall has a Venetian theme, and has indoor canals where gondolas will take you around the mall. The mall has a few major national chains, such as Ann Taylor and Banana Republic, and many designer and upscale shops. It's a large, multilevel glass enclosure in which lions frolic during various times of day. In addition to regular viewing spots, you can walk through a glass tunnel and get a worm's-eye view of the underside of a lion (provided one is in position); note how very big Kitty's paws are. Multiple lions share show duties (about 6 hr. on and then 2 days off at a ranch for some free-range activity, so they're never cooped up here for long). You could see any combo, from one giant male to a pack of five females who have grown from cub to adult size during their MGM time. | #24 of 30 Things To Do in Las Vegas Shark Reef at Mandalay Bay Las Vegas NV ~1.51 miles from Las Vegas city center Hotels Close to Shark Reef at Mandalay Bay The Shark Reef Aquarium at Mandalay Bay is a public aquarium located at and owned by the Mandalay Bay Resort and Casino in Las Vegas, Nevada. Its main tank is 1,300,000 US gallons (4,900,000 l; 1,080,000 imp gal), the third largest in North America. The facility is 95,000 sq ft (8,800 m2), and displays numerous different species of sharks, rays, fish, reptiles, and marine invertebrates. It also features a shark tunnel.The Shark Reef Aquarium is the only Nevada institution accredited by the American Zoo and Aquarium Association. While most aquariums are located close to the ocean, the Shark Reef is exceptional in that it is located in a desert, far from any natural water source. The reef was developed in consultation with the Vancouver Aquarium. | #25 of 30 Things To Do in Las Vegas Orleans Arena Las Vegas NV - (702) 284-7777 ~1.71 miles from Las Vegas city center Hotels Close to Orleans Arena

The 337-acre (136 ha) campus is located approximately 1.5 mi (2.4 km) east of the Las Vegas Strip. Ground breaking on the original 60 acres (24 ha) site was in April 1956, and the university purchased a 640 acres (260 ha) site in North Las Vegas for future expansion. The institution includes a Shadow Lane Campus, located just east of the University Medical Center of Southern Nevada. The university has been deemed a "research-intensive university" by The Carnegie Foundation for the Advancement of Teaching. |
